New York-based ad agency will open Memphis office

Getting your Trinity Audio player ready...

With a $112 million Navy contract as incentive, a large New York-based advertising firm will open a Memphis office.

The new Young & Rubicam Inc. (Y&R) office will house 50 employees at Brinkley Plaza Downtown who will work on helping the Navy recruit. The firm intends to infuse the Memphis team with “top talent from the region.” Y&R will work in partnership with affiliates Wunderman, Burson-Marsteller, VML and MEC, all part of the global WPP plc.

 

The Navy contract — estimated to be worth as much as $457 million over the next five years — is not the sole focus of the new office. The office’s managing director will be actively engaging new clients to expand Y&R’s work in the area.
